論開源文化 三 從李開復的跳槽經歷看開源文化

2021-09-05 06:36:34 字數 3986 閱讀 4893

<?xml:namespace prefix = o ns = "urn:schemas-microsoft-com:office:office" />

論開源文化(三)

---從李開復的跳槽經歷看開源文化

唐永忠

3  建設「開源文化」的意義

在詮釋了「開源」和「文化」這兩個構成要素之後,我們就可以正式**什麼是「開源文化」。

雖然我們已經提出建設開源文化的構想,但仍然會有相當多的各界人士在詢問乙個問題,為什麼要建設開源文化。

3.0

研究建設「開源文化」意義的重要性

「為什麼要建設開源文化」,這個問題實際上是一系列問題的濃縮,它至少可以再細化為如下

3個小問題: (

1)是否需要建設一種單獨的開源文化?這個問題的另乙個表述就是:難道現有的軟體公司,如微軟公司的企業文化,就不能直接作為開源文化嗎? (

2)建設開源文化有什麼作用?這個問題的另乙個表述就是:這種文化究竟對社會、對個人有什麼直接的作用? (

3)開源文化是否有發展空間?這個問題的另乙個表述就是:在絕大多數軟體開發人才都將投身到諸如微軟公司這種私有軟體公司中,開源文化究竟有有沒有建設成功的可能性? 第

1個小問題是指開源文化是否有建設的必要?如果沒有建設的必要,討論建設開源文化就毫無必要的事情。 第

2個小問題是指開源文化是否有建設的利益?如果沒有利益,誰會有興趣參與到開源文化的建設中,如果沒有人參與,討論建設開源文化就只能是討論者自己的一廂情願? 第

3個小問題是指開源文化是否有建設的可能?如果沒有可能,即使其利益(在沒有可能的條件下,所謂利益只能是潛在的利益),討論建設開源文化不久成了空中樓閣?

很顯然,如果上述

3個小問題不能給予合理的解釋,關於建設開源文化的構想就真的只是乙個胡思亂想。

3.1 

建設「開源文化」的必要性

要回答這個問題,就不可避免涉及要到微軟公司(這個世界上最大的軟體公司,也是世界上所有私有軟體的鼻祖)的企業文化。

通常來說,長期居於行業領先地位的公司,其企業文化通常就是最適合這個行業的企業文化,而其企業文化也常常是其保持市場領袖地位的主要因素。因此,這家公司的企業文化必然被競爭者在企業文化建設過程中積極效仿,這已經成為市場慣例。

對於那些反對建設開源文化的人士,包括那些根本就沒有想過要建設開源文化的業內人士,基本上是基於上述市場慣例而對待開源文化的。

如果微軟公司的企業文化是軟體行業最合適的企業文化,開源文化的確沒有建設的必要了。然而問題在於,即使微軟公司的企業文化曾在相當長的時間內是軟體行業最適合的企業文化,從更深層的角度看,它是否依然有其內在的缺陷呢?

讓我們先看乙個最著名的案例:李開復離開微軟公司的案例。

2023年7

月,李開復離開微軟公司加盟谷歌公司,這是該年度

it業界頗具影響的最大事件。與通常的人才流動不同,微軟公司對此很生氣,不惜與李開復對簿公堂。

雖然李開復離開微軟加入谷歌可能還有不可告人的理由,但李開復本人公開給出的理由是:「我更希望進入乙個谷歌的這種奇蹟魔術師的創新,像童話世界般的乙個每乙個人都很快樂地工作的乙個環境。」;「谷歌是乙個特別能夠迅速在網際網路創新的公司,那麼相對來說,微軟是乙個比較穩重的,過去的傳統軟體業的大公司,」;「微軟這種公司類似工廠,

google

更加類似大學,想法和做法都自由,沒有太多的束縛。」

按照李開復本人的原話,我們可以認定,曾經最適合軟體行業的微軟公司的企業文化的確已經不再最適合未來軟體行業的發展了:第一,微軟已經成為軟體工廠,而不再是軟體研究的場所;第二,微軟已經失去創新的風格了。

那麼,谷歌這家成功挖走微軟全球副總裁的公司的企業文化是否就是新的最適合軟體行業的企業文化了呢?

現在看來,谷歌無非是新乙個微軟,甚至是衰老速度比微軟還快的新微軟。也正是這個理由,李開復在

2009

年又離開谷歌公司。這次,他並沒有跳槽到競爭對手那裡,而是選擇了自我創業。

我們並不否認微軟公司(包括以其為代表的一類公司)的企業文化仍然有其適合軟體行業的地方,但完全複製微軟公司的企業文化,的確已經不能完全適應未來軟體發展的需要了。軟體行業需要建設真正超越微軟公司企業文化(而不是翻新微軟公司企業文化)的文化,這種文化甚至都不能成為企業文化,而只能稱為社群文化。

3.2 

建設「開源文化」的真正作用

為什麼我們要提倡建設開源文化,在於這種軟體社群文化具有以微軟公司為代表的軟體企業的企業文化所沒有的特殊作用。

我仍以李開復的案例來說明這一點。

從李開復本人的原話以及其後來離開谷歌公司執行產業的經歷,我們至少可以發現,類似李開復這樣的人才(甚至比其水平更高人才,乃至天才),其嚮往的工作場所應該有5點:

(1)創新型(「谷歌是乙個特別能夠迅速在網際網路創新的公司」)而不是穩重型(微軟是乙個比較穩重的大公司)的公司; (

2)類似大學(

google

更加類似大學)而不是類似工廠(微軟這種公司類似工廠)的公司; (

3)有著自由感覺(

google

想法和做法都自由,沒有太多的束縛)的公司; (

4)有著奇蹟魔術師或童話世界般感覺的公司; (

5)能夠每乙個人都很快樂地工作的公司。

李開復一直在嚮往著有這樣的公司,這也是他一直跳槽的原因:從蘋果公司跳槽到

sgi公司,從

sgi公司跳槽到微軟公司,再從微軟公司跳槽到谷歌公司。但他最終的結局說明,只要是一家公司,就不可能真正達到上述

5點要求。最終,李開復只能選擇自己創業。

為什麼任何一家公司都不可能真正達到上述

5點要求呢?原因很簡單,公司就是由工廠發展起來的,公司的本質只能是工廠而不可能是大學。而在一家工廠裡,規範是第一位的,自由根本沒有充分發展的空間。

對於所有類似李開復,甚至超越李開復的軟體人才,包括軟體相關人才,那種能夠給予童話世界感覺,從而可以每個人每一天都自由而快樂的工作,能夠向大學那樣始終創新的場所,只能有兩種,或者就是大學本身,或者是開源社群。

對於絕大多數類似或超越李開復這樣的軟體人才或軟體相關人才,可能並不安心一輩子只呆在像象牙塔般高貴而狹隘的大學裡,他們也嚮往能夠把設想轉換為現實的價值。因此,對於絕大多數類似或超越李開復這樣的軟體人才或軟體相關人才來說,開源社群或許才是他們真正的歸宿。

之所以會這樣,就在於只有開源文化能夠提供這5點:

(1)創新的感覺; (

2)同學間或好友間的感覺; (

3)自由的感覺; (

4)童話世界的感覺; (

5)快樂工作的感覺。

在這裡,我們這樣概括開源社群:

這是所有一生擁有創新夢想的人才能夠快樂而自由創造的童話世界。

3.2 

建設「開源文化」的可行性

只要了解了開源文化的真正作用,實際上就可以知道,這種文化是必然會發展起來的,即使面臨著社會、心靈的種種挑戰。 (

1)真正的人才必然會嚮往創新

對於真正的人才來說,創新是其作為人才最重要的標誌,那種真正給予創新感覺的文化必然是其嚮往的文化,因此,開源文化必然是真正的軟體及相關人才嚮往的文化。只要有了這個嚮往,開源文化的建設就最為堅實的社會基礎。 (

2)真正的人才必然會嚮往知音

對於人才來說,可能最痛苦的事情是懷才不遇,無人理解。因此,中國古人就放言:「女為悅己者容,士為知己者死」。

對人才來說,知音可能會有兩種,一種是上級,另一種是知心朋友。實際上,即使上級是伯樂,人才和上級之間依然有著難以逾越的身份鴻溝,這種知的狀態並不是雙向的,基本是伯樂知人才,而人才卻未必知伯樂。相反,在知心朋友之間,缺水雙向的相知。 (

3)真正的人才必然會嚮往自由、夢幻和快樂

嚮往自由、夢幻和快樂是所有人的天性,人才同樣不例外。只是由於人才的特殊,他們對這

3種心情的嚮往會更加強烈。甚至出現這樣的情況,越是才華橫溢的人才,一旦失去自由,一旦缺少夢幻,一旦不再快樂,他們的才華就煙消雲散,他們可能連普通人都比不上。

展望現今的世界,基本上是私有軟體的一統天下,但是非私有軟體一直都在頑強地生存著。這些一直頑強生存的非私有軟體及其推行者,就是已經埋藏在大地中的那些一直不死的種子。只要有了適宜的天氣、光照、水和生命元素的保證,種子的發芽是必然的。

redis集群三主三從redis cli

port 7000 dir usr local redisdata daemonize yes logfile 7000.log dbfilename dump 7000.rdb cluster enabled yes cluster node timeout 15000 cluster confi...

Redis集群搭建 三主三從

redis集群介紹 redis 是乙個開源的 key value 儲存系統,由於出眾的效能,大部分網際網路企業都用來做伺服器端快取。redis在3.0版本之前只支援單例項模式 雖然支援主從模式,哨兵模式來解決單點故障,可是網際網路公司動輒幾百g的資料,顯然是沒辦法滿足業務需求的。所以redis在3....

三 從網線到網路裝置

三 1 訊號在網線和集線器中傳輸 訊號流出網絡卡進入網線 到達集線器,並將輸入訊號廣播到集線器的所有埠上 訊號到達連線在集線器上的所有裝置,這些裝置收到訊號後通過mac頭部中接收方mac位址判斷如果是發給自己的則接受,否則忽略,這樣網路包到達指定mac位址的接收方 2 交換機的包 操作 注 模擬宿舍...